I own a 2009 Z06 and just finished heads and big cam. It should be Dynoed tomorrowed, and I was wondering what should the norm be.
I have 102 fast air, 102 throttle body, BB long tubes, no Cats, BB exhuast, and a cold air system. |
What are the cam specs?
What kinda heads & compression? Which cold air intake? Pump or race gas? With a big street-able cam on 93 I'd say between 600-610rwhp is tops. The norm with a moderate - big cam and all other mods is 580-590rwhp |
Cam is Comp 246/259 624 116
Basically a 293lrrComp cam with more LSA K&N Cold air Heads has been reworked, ported & polished Pump gas Checking on compression |
560-610rwhp. Depends on dyno, tuning, etc. Should run good.
